/* * INET		An implementation of the TCP/IP protocol suite for the LINUX *		operating system.  INET is implemented using the  BSD Socket *		interface as the means of communication with the user level. * *		Pseudo-driver for the loopback interface. * * Version:	@(#)loopback.c	1.0.4b	08/16/93 * * Authors:	Ross Biro, <bir7@leland.Stanford.Edu> *		Fred N. van Kempen, <waltje@uWalt.NL.Mugnet.ORG> *		Donald Becker, <becker@scyld.com> * *		Alan Cox	:	Fixed oddments for NET3.014 *		Alan Cox	:	Rejig for NET3.029 snap #3 *		Alan Cox	: 	Fixed NET3.029 bugs and sped up *		Larry McVoy	:	Tiny tweak to double performance *		Alan Cox	:	Backed out LMV's tweak - the linux mm *					can't take it... *              Michael Griffith:       Don't bother computing the checksums *                                      on packets received on the loopback *                                      interface. *		Alexey Kuznetsov:	Potential hang under some extreme *					cases removed. * *		This program is free software; you can redistribute it and/or *		modify it under the terms of the GNU General Public License *		as published by the Free Software Foundation; either version *		2 of the License, or (at your option) any later version. */#include <linux/kernel.h>#include <linux/sched.h>#include <linux/interrupt.h>#include <linux/fs.h>#include <linux/types.h>#include <linux/string.h>#include <linux/socket.h>#include <linux/errno.h>#include <linux/fcntl.h>#include <linux/in.h>#include <linux/init.h>#include <asm/system.h>#include <asm/uaccess.h>#include <asm/io.h>#include <linux/inet.h>#include <linux/netdevice.h>#include <linux/etherdevice.h>#include <linux/skbuff.h>#include <net/sock.h>#include <linux/if_ether.h>	/* For the statistics structure. */#include <linux/if_arp.h>	/* For ARPHRD_ETHER */#define LOOPBACK_OVERHEAD (128 + MAX_HEADER + 16 + 16)/* * The higher levels take care of making this non-reentrant (it's * called with bh's disabled). */static int loopback_xmit(struct sk_buff *skb, struct net_device *dev){	struct net_device_stats *stats = (struct net_device_stats *)dev->priv;	/*	 *	Optimise so buffers with skb->free=1 are not copied but	 *	instead are lobbed from tx queue to rx queue 	 */	if(atomic_read(&skb->users) != 1)	{	  	struct sk_buff *skb2=skb;	  	skb=skb_clone(skb, GFP_ATOMIC);		/* Clone the buffer */	  	if(skb==NULL) {			kfree_skb(skb2);			return 0;		}	  	kfree_skb(skb2);	}	else		skb_orphan(skb);	skb->protocol=eth_type_trans(skb,dev);	skb->dev=dev;#ifndef LOOPBACK_MUST_CHECKSUM	skb->ip_summed = CHECKSUM_UNNECESSARY;#endif	dev->last_rx = jiffies;	stats->rx_bytes+=skb->len;	stats->tx_bytes+=skb->len;	stats->rx_packets++;	stats->tx_packets++;	netif_rx(skb);	return(0);}static struct net_device_stats *get_stats(struct net_device *dev){	return (struct net_device_stats *)dev->priv;}/* Initialize the rest of the LOOPBACK device. */int __init loopback_init(struct net_device *dev){	dev->mtu		= (16 * 1024) + 20 + 20 + 12;	dev->hard_start_xmit	= loopback_xmit;	dev->hard_header	= eth_header;	dev->hard_header_cache	= eth_header_cache;	dev->header_cache_update= eth_header_cache_update;	dev->hard_header_len	= ETH_HLEN;		/* 14			*/	dev->addr_len		= ETH_ALEN;		/* 6			*/	dev->tx_queue_len	= 0;	dev->type		= ARPHRD_LOOPBACK;	/* 0x0001		*/	dev->rebuild_header	= eth_rebuild_header;	dev->flags		= IFF_LOOPBACK;	dev->features		= NETIF_F_SG|NETIF_F_FRAGLIST|NETIF_F_NO_CSUM|NETIF_F_HIGHDMA;	dev->priv = kmalloc(sizeof(struct net_device_stats), GFP_KERNEL);	if (dev->priv == NULL)			return -ENOMEM;	memset(dev->priv, 0, sizeof(struct net_device_stats));	dev->get_stats = get_stats;	/*	 *	Fill in the generic fields of the device structure. 	 */   	return(0);};
